MK1 Muffler Rattle - Internal Repair
I have been dealing with a very annoying rattle from the passenger's side muffler on my 2000 C2. These mufflers have an inlet tube, a crossover tube, and an outlet tube that work together with the three chambers to muffle the exhaust. I used a plasma cutter to open an access panel in the outboard side of the can and found most of the welds had fatigued and failed. The crossover tube was loose and causing the rattle. I used a mig to re-weld the tubes and then a tig to reseal the access panel. Attached are a few pictures for reference in case others run into a similar problem.

How has your repair held up? Looks like a nice job but I don't have those tools.
I have the same problem on my '00 C2 as well (driver's side). I am buying one used muffler from eBay for $90+40 shipping = $130. The "donor" muffler has 52k miles on it. Junkyards are quoting $175-185 shipped for one muffler, FYI.
